Jean Van den Bosch, guitarist and vocalist, was one of the original three members of The Vipers Skiffle Group (founded in 1956) along with Wally Whyton and Johnny Martyn. They were later joined by Tony Tolhurst on bass and John Pilgrim on percussion and washboard. Originally a wire salesman before he joined, [1] Van den Bosch left the group in 1958. [2] He was described by fellow Viper, John Pilgrim, as having a "deep baritone voice and percussive guitar style" [3]
